PDA

View Full Version : "on cancel" operation?


cgbeige
12-27-2010, 05:48 PM
I made a batch script but when you try and cancel it, it still runs through the "for each" operations until you cancel each one. Is there a way to say "on cancel" and then tell it to skip to the restore scene state portion of the script?

haggi
12-27-2010, 08:10 PM
Could you explain what type of batch script you mean?
Mayabatch? Mel? bat File? bash File? python script?

cgbeige
12-27-2010, 08:48 PM
here's the MEL code for the portion that handles the batch bake portion:

global proc daveBake420()
{
string $currentRenderName = `textFieldGrp -q -text -forceChangeCommand vrayFileNamePrefix`;
$mySelection = `ls -sl`;
for($each in $mySelection)
{
select -r $each;
textFieldGrp -e -text $each -forceChangeCommand vrayFileNamePrefix;
RedoPreviousRender;
print ($each + "baked\n");
}
textFieldGrp -e -text "" -forceChangeCommand vrayFileNamePrefix;
textFieldGrp -e -text $currentRenderName -forceChangeCommand vrayFileNamePrefix;
}

CGTalk Moderation
12-27-2010, 08:49 PM
This thread has been automatically closed as it remained inactive for 12 months. If you wish to continue the discussion, please create a new thread in the appropriate forum.